How much money does it take to start a coffee truck?

The average cost to open a coffee truck is between $20,000-$50,000. Coffee trailers can be started for less, ranging from $10,000-$50,000. Espresso carts cost even less, ranging from $2,000-$5,000. The cost of a coffee truck, trailer or cart is greatly dependent on the equipment installed.

Is a coffee trailer profitable?

Well the average coffee truck that is out five days a week averages 800 to 1,000 sales per day of coffee sales alone. If they add on bagels, danish pastries, panini sandwiches, cookies or other upsell items like other coffee shops do, they can potentially double their sales.

Do you need a Licence for a coffee van?

You may need a licence for each location you intend trading. Expect a backlash from anyone in the area already selling coffee. You’ll most likely need a tax clearance cert, HSE cert, proof of insurance, to accompany your application.

Can you make money with a coffee truck?

How Profitable is a Coffee Truck? Based on our survey of 223 full-time food truck owners, over 50% report generating at least $150,000 in revenue per year. Coffee truck owners can expect to see similar revenues if you operate the business full-time and establishing name recognition locally.
